SonicNet Chat July 8, 1998

 

Metallica: Howdy its James here in

the Van on the way to Cuyahoga

Falls, Ohio.

Frogs_on_tour : James how does

it feel to be a father?

Metallica: I feel like a grown up now.

GwenStefaniReal : Hey James, do

you still have marks or burns from

that huge flame? And did you find it

harder to play guitar after that?

Metallica: No I was very dedicated

to rehab and I was very in to playing

guitar again.

Harvester_666_Sorrow : Will you

guys ever consider returning to your

old HARD style again?

Metallica: Metallica is not in to

moving backwards. As human s

which doesn't mean we won't

necessarily playing harder stuff

again.

Freik_TFA : To James: I heard that

you originally only wanted to sing in

the band, and not play guitar. Is that

true?

Metallica: Yes, that was the original

plan, we couldn't really find any one

to play guitar the way I wanted them

to. So I originally ended up doing

both, singing and playing.

Kurt_2010 : Where did you come

up with the name "Metallica"?

Metallica: Lars stole it from a list of

magazine titles that a friend was

trying to get together in possibly

1980 or 81.

guest_d8d36985 : Who do you

consider the best guitarist?

Metallica: Best guitarist ever?

Hummm Well there's a few that I

consider good in their own worlds.

Jimmy Page for his mad scientist

approach. Johnny Ramone of the

Ramones for developing a fast down

picking style. Angus Young for his

simplistic but tasty leads.

Psychoeagle : How did you come

up with the new symbol ?

Metallica: James drew it on the front

of a notebook one day. It is the

forever spinning Ninja star

representing the four members of

Metallica spinning in a constant

motion.
